Oil Furnace Replacement in Kansas City, MO
Oil furnace replacement services involve removing an outdated or malfunctioning oil-powered heating system and installing a new unit to ensure reliable warmth throughout the property. These projects typically cover the complete removal of the existing furnace, proper disposal of old equipment, and the installation of a new, efficient oil furnace tailored to the home's heating needs. Property owners often seek this service when their current furnace no longer operates effectively, has frequent breakdowns, or when upgrading for improved energy efficiency and performance.
Before requesting oil furnace replacement, homeowners usually want to understand the scope of work involved, including the size and type of the new furnace suitable for their home, as well as any necessary modifications to existing ductwork or fuel lines. It’s also common to inquire about the expected benefits of new systems, such as better heating performance and potential energy savings. Clarifying these details helps property owners make informed decisions about their heating upgrades and ensures the installation aligns with their comfort and budget preferences.

Oil Furnace Replacement Questions
When is it time to replace an oil furnace? Replacement may be needed if the furnace is frequently breaking down, making excessive noise, or showing signs of inefficiency and aging.
What are the benefits of replacing an oil furnace? Upgrading can improve heating efficiency, reduce energy costs, and provide more reliable warmth during colder months.
What types of oil furnaces are available for replacement? There are various models designed for residential use, including high-efficiency units that meet modern performance standards.
How can property owners prepare for an oil furnace replacement? Clearing the area around the furnace and informing household members about the project can help ensure a smooth replacement process.
